Noun

freight yard (plural freight yards)

  1. A rail yard for freight cars, typically designed for loading and unloading cargo and sorting locomotives.
    • 1929, Ernest Hemingway, A Farewell to Arms, Folio Society 2008, p. 85:
      We got into Milan early in the morning and they unloaded us in the freight yard.
